Output 104a96dec32a99024b07fdcc31b2db704525daedec03f32e9141ec5c10291911:1

value
9698217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 36579063a6d3b04c76a79052f653d4d990c10757 OP_EQUALVERIFY OP_CHECKSIG
address
15xLPQzXV5PrwywUigyXp6m8rmGA4hUEVa
transaction
104a96dec32a99024b07fdcc31b2db704525daedec03f32e9141ec5c10291911
spent
true